Chalgali

Chalgali is a village located in Shankargarh tehsil of Surguja district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Shankargarh (tehsildar office) and 65km away from district headquarter Ambikapur. As per 2009 stats, Chalgali village is also a gram panchayat.

About Chalgali

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chalgali is 432444. The village spans a total geographical area of 368.95 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 497118. Ambikapur is nearest town to Chalgali village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 65km away.

Population of Chalgali

According to the 2011 Census, Chalgali has a total population of about 959, with approximately 481 males and 478 females. The sex ratio is around 993 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 134 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 197 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 467. The overall literacy rate is approximately 47.13%, with male literacy at about 57.38% and female literacy near 36.82%. There are around 225 households in the village. Connectivity of Chalgali

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chalgali. As per the 2011 stats, Chalgali had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
